I love reading screenplays. I find they're more tightly written than novels and (obviously) more visual. A simple google search of "screenplays" finds a huge heap on the net in basic html/txt, which makes them easy to download and convert.

I've downloaded and converted some golden oldies and some recent titles.

This is for my own use, and I have no intention of sharing them. Could someone tell me if this is illegal to do? If I had saved the original screenplay to my desktop computer, and then read it there, is that okay?

Does the act of converting the file, and putting it on my Sony make it illegal?

Or are the screenplays, even though they are in plain view on the net, and not on torrent, illegal in themselves?
